North American Carbon World Program

California Legislative Action and Carbon Markets
03.26.2025 | 1:30-2:30 PM

Recent and impending legislative actions in California continue to demonstrate that California remains on the cutting edge for climate action. Whether one views recent developments positively or negatively, ongoing debates on many fronts have rekindled interest in Sacramento’s agenda and ignited debates about whether proposals help or hinder climate action. This session will provide an up-to-date assessment of where legislative action may be going, including requirements for disclosing climate risks, potential changes to California’s Cap-and-Trade program, and impacts on the voluntary carbon market.

Speakers:

  • Nico van Aelstyn Partner, Sheppard Mullin
  • Katelyn Roedner Sutter, California State Director, Environmental Defense Fund
  • Michelle Passero, Director of Climate and Nature-based Solutions, The Nature Conservancy
  • Alfredo Arredondo, Partner, Resolute
  • Richard Corey, Partner, AJW
